S26E13 · Survival Part 2

Paterson rallies the group to brutal survival tactics

Paterson seizes command by shifting the group’s moral compass toward ruthless pragmatism, branding weakness as lethal. His litany of kill-or-be-killed logic strips away any pretense of mercy, casting the planet’s relentless predators and their own treacherous leader as existential threats that demand reciprocal brutality. Midge’s enthusiastic echo and Paterson’s escalating call to purge “shirkers and deadwood” weld the survivors into a hardened faction; their unity hardens into a pact weaponized by desperation as the planet’s core collapse accelerates and the Master’s betrayal looms larger every moment.

Cheetah Homeworld (Hunting Grounds)

The desolate expanse of Cheetah World provides the stark and unforgiving backdrop for this pivotal shift in group cohesion. Under a violet sky choked with volcanic ash, Patterson leverages the planet’s inherent hostility to justify his ruthless doctrine of elimination and survival. The cracked earth and skeletal remains of flora and fauna mirror the survivors’ own moral erosion, as the environment becomes not just a battleground but a mirror of their brutalized reasoning.
